We’d see from scriptures that God’s word delivers in thirtyfold, sixtyfold, and hundredfold. In other words, it’s able to deliver part and all of your need. For instance; Phil 4:19 says that “God shall supply all your needs according to His riches in glory through Christ Jesus”; if you believe that scripture to meet a need, and all you could get was half of what was needed, then you’ve not gotten a hundredfold of what that scripture says. It didn’t say “God shall supply half of your needs”; rather, it says “God shall supply all your needs”. So if you get anything less that all, then that scripture has not fully delivered in your life.
However, the problem is not with the scripture, neither is it with God; the problem is with your understanding. Many believers are too quick to assume God’s will when their needs are not met as expected, even when God’s will is clearly stated in scriptures. If God says “all”, then He means “all”. I remember how I believed God to make N20000 on a certain day, but contrary to what I expected, the first money I received on that day was N5000. However, because I understood God’s word for me, I didn’t break my expectation. Miraculously, I made N20000 before that day ended. When it comes to having faith in God’s word, what you receive first is often a test to see if you still need the rest.
